What does "hall" mean?
-
noun A passage or corridor inside a building.
"Her office is at the end of the hall."
-
noun A large room used for meetings, events, or gatherings.
"The wedding reception was held in the town hall."
-
noun A large house, especially a historic manor.
"The estate is known locally simply as "the Hall.""
